About Brewer Family Law
Brewer Family Law is a California Legal Document Assistant (LDA) firm, a profession formerly known as an Independent Paralegal, focused on helping everyday people access the court system in an affordable, practical, and respectful way. Authorized under California Business and Professions Code §§ 6400–6415, registered and bonded Legal Document Assistants are permitted to prepare legal documents and provide general procedural information for self-represented (pro per) clients, at the client’s direction, without giving legal advice or acting as attorneys. This structure allows clients to remain fully in control of their case while receiving professional document preparation support.
